> There are difference rules for compiling c source file in different
> testcases. In order to enable KBUILD_OUTPUT support in later patch,
> this patch introduce the default rules in
> "tools/testing/selftest/lib.mk" and remove the existing rules in each
> testcase.
>
> Signed-off-by: Bamvor Jian Zhang <bamvor.zhangjian@...aro.org>
> ---
>  tools/testing/selftests/exec/Makefile  | 2 --
>  tools/testing/selftests/lib.mk         | 3 +++
>  tools/testing/selftests/mount/Makefile | 3 ---
>  tools/testing/selftests/net/Makefile   | 2 --
>  tools/testing/selftests/size/Makefile  | 4 +---
>  tools/testing/selftests/vm/Makefile    | 3 +--
>  6 files changed, 5 insertions(+), 12 deletions(-)
>
> diff --git a/tools/testing/selftests/exec/Makefile b/tools/testing/selftests/exec/Makefile
> index b3bf091..9eb1c3e 100644
> --- a/tools/testing/selftests/exec/Makefile
> +++ b/tools/testing/selftests/exec/Makefile
> @@ -11,8 +11,6 @@ execveat.symlink: execveat
>  execveat.denatured: execveat
>         cp $< $@
>         chmod -x $@
> -%: %.c
> -       $(CC) $(CFLAGS) -o $@ $^
>
>  TEST_GEN_PROGS := execveat
>  TEST_GEN_FILES := execveat.symlink execveat.denatured script subdir
> diff --git a/tools/testing/selftests/lib.mk b/tools/testing/selftests/lib.mk
> index 8c0440d..9ccec4b 100644
> --- a/tools/testing/selftests/lib.mk
> +++ b/tools/testing/selftests/lib.mk
> @@ -45,4 +45,7 @@ all: $(TEST_GEN_PROGS) $(TEST_GEN_PROGS_EXTENDED) $(TEST_GEN_FILES)
>  clean:
>         $(RM) -fr $(TEST_GEN_PROGS) $(TEST_GEN_PROGS_EXTENDED) $(TEST_GEN_FILES)
>
> +%: %.c
> +       $(CC) $(CFLAGS) $(LDFLAGS) $(LDLIBS) -o $@ $^
> +
>  .PHONY: run_tests all clean install emit_tests
